Premium Hotels in Bali
Bali
Ubud
Nusa Penida​
Ubud
Bali
Nusa Penida​
You are booking hotel for more than 30 days
Seminyak, Bali | 1.6 km drive to Seminyak Beach
Bali
Ubud
Nusa Penida​
Ubud
Bali
Nusa Penida​
Jimbaran
Ubud
Sanur
Canggu
Sanur
Sanur
Jimbaran
Canggu
Nusa Dua
Seminyak
North Kuta
Denpasar
Kuta
Tabanan
Canggu
Nusa Penida​
Ubud
Sanur
Ubud
Tabanan